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ature mitra mutua
Definition Cubierta que se ponían los obispos y algunos abades en la cabeza a las funciones litúrgicas solemnes. Asociación, entidad o agrupación con un régimen colectivo de servicios o prestaciones.

Why the eye confuses mitra with mutua

A purely visual mix-up. mitra ([ˈmit̪ɾa]) and mutua ([ˈmut̪wa])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they share most of their letters but differ in 2 positions.
